Primary responsibilities include:
- Responsible for drafting and generating a range of legal documents, such as standard engagement letters, non-disclosure agreements (NDAs), Master Service Agreements (MSAs), as well as Statements of Work (SOW) and Scopes of Work (SOW) when required
- Work closely with internal and outside legal counsel on various legal matters, including contract changes, debt collection, bankruptcy issues, and responses to subpoenas
- Follow up on in-flight contract drafts as needed with leads/prospective clients to bring closure and expedite contract execution to the extent possible
- Maintain a tracker of contracts drafted, contracts executed, terminations, etc., to distribute to the partners on a regular cadence for transparency purposes
- Support the COO and CFO in preparing and responding to requests for information from regulatory bodies such as FINRA
- Serve as the central custodian for incoming information, ensuring its proper entry into firm’s CRM and facilitating its distribution to relevant parties as needed
- Serve as key contact for client and CRM related incoming inquiries
- Provide a variety of project management, administrative, and operational support for the Legal & Finance teams’ daily operations
